Ashiya’s Song

So now I stand before you, my friends, my companions, and my mentors, having told the tale of my life and death and re-birth, to repeat to you my oath as a Champion of Valaria.

I swear to uphold the Code of the Valarians.

I swear to defend and protect the innocent, the shapeshifters, and the pristine places of the world.

I swear to battle against those who threaten the world: the Pylos Lords, the necromancers and their followers, the warpspawn, the common evils and evil men that plague this land.

To these oaths I add these more:

I swear to honor Elethay by whose grace I am restored by fulfilling my destiny by becoming a Priestess of the Silver Lady.

I swear to honor those by whose sacrifices I am restored by aiding them and emulating them and becoming a Mentor and Glyph Master as they were and will be again.

I swear to honor the dreams and desires that I have been granted by this second chance at life by taking up the crafts of Shaman, Bard and Scholar.

I swear these oaths by my heritage as a Dragon.

I swear these oaths by my training as a Valarian and a Wizard.

I swear these oaths by my craft as a Nightwitch and acolyte of the Silver Lady.

I swear these oaths by my faith and by names of Elethay I worship: Silver Lady, Lady of Changes, Queen of Night, Lady of the Four Faces.

I swear these oaths by my common name: Ashiya Sharr’s-daughter.

I swear these oaths by my secret name.

So let it be.
